Montreal, Apr. 19, 2005 - Montreal Alouettes Vice-President and General Manager Jim Popp and Assistant General Manager Marcel Desjardins are ready for the 2006 CFL Draft to be held this Thursday, Apr. 20 at 12 p.m.
The Alouettes will have a total of six selections over the six rounds of the draft, including the seventh overall pick. The experts will have to keep an eye on the Alouettes until the very end, as the team boasts 22 Canadian draft picks on its current roster including 17 who were selected directly by the Alouettes and three sixth-round picks in Michael Botterill, Dave Stala and Adam Eckert.

Here's a look at the Alouettes' 2006 draft picks:
Draft 2006
Round Number of picks Ranks of picks (round) Ranks of picks (overall)
1st 1 7 7
2nd 1 8 16
3rd 1 7 24
4th 2 7 (a), 8 32,33
5th 1 7 41
6th 0 (b) - -
Acquired from the B.C. Lions in 2005 in exchange for James Whitley.
Traded to the Winnipeg Blue Bombers in 2005 along with Aaron Fiacconi and future considerations for Dave Mudge.
